This is an industrial-grade AMS-A6500-RC relay card that provides high reliability for the plant's critical rotating machinery. This system is designed for monitoring steam, gas, compressors and hydraulic turbomachinery. Its relay module has 16 channel outputs, can receive clear, alarm, or alarm signals as input, and can be selected in combination with Boolean logic and application time delay.
The AMS-A6500-RC is a communication card for redundant devices with ModBus and rack interface modules designed for the most reliable rotating machinery in the plant. It can read parameters from all AMSA6500 ATG modules and output them via ModBus TCP/IP and/or ModBus RTU (serial). In addition, OPC UA can be used to transfer data to third-party systems. The module can also power a local graphic display at the guard for racks of machine and instrument readings.
